Although leaf spring steel sheets can be found in junkyards, it may be necessary to adapt the design to the various thicknesses that can be achieved.

True, in any case, consideration is very simple. for each millimeter that the thickness of the blades increases, the bushings will increase their length by 2 mm --Inddigital (talk) 18:51, 20 January 2023 (CET)
The same would happen with the width of the central support (piece 2.2) --xtech2020_review (talk) 18:57, 20 January 2023 (CET)

Why do you choose the Metal Extreme machine as your main reference?

This machine was taken as a reference because of:
  • Its Characteristics, it can cut sheet up to 3mm thick and 205mm long
  • Clarity of explanations regarding dimensions and processes
  • The precision in the cuts that is observed
